You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@atlas.apache.org by sa...@apache.org on 2019/09/13 23:35:01 UTC
[atlas] branch master updated: ATLAS-3378: Update JanusGraph to
0.4.0
This is an automated email from the ASF dual-hosted git repository.
sarath p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/atlas.git
The following commit(s) were added to refs/heads/master by this push:
new 314f493 ATLAS-3378: Update JanusGraph to 0.4.0
314f493 is described below
commit 314f49372d913532e29d8a3ec0494bb1f2f2d2fc
Author: Sarath Subramanian <sa...@apache.org>
AuthorDate: Fri Sep 13 15:38:15 2019 -0700
ATLAS-3378: Update JanusGraph to 0.4.0
---
addons/falcon-bridge/pom.xml | 4 ++++
addons/hbase-bridge/pom.xml | 4 ++++
addons/hive-bridge/pom.xml | 4 ++++
addons/impala-bridge/pom.xml | 4 ++++
addons/kafka-bridge/pom.xml | 4 ++++
addons/sqoop-bridge/pom.xml | 4 ++++
addons/storm-bridge/pom.xml | 4 ++++
graphdb/api/pom.xml | 2 +-
graphdb/janus/pom.xml | 4 +---
.../org/apache/atlas/repository/graphdb/janus/AtlasJanusGraph.java | 2 +-
pom.xml | 5 ++++-
webapp/pom.xml | 6 +++++-
12 files changed, 40 insertions(+), 7 deletions(-)
diff --git a/addons/falcon-bridge/pom.xml b/addons/falcon-bridge/pom.xml
index df869b7..c53d0ef 100644
--- a/addons/falcon-bridge/pom.xml
+++ b/addons/falcon-bridge/pom.xml
@@ -269,6 +269,10 @@
<key>embedded.solr.directory</key>
<value>${project.build.directory}</value>
</syst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
+ </syst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>
<stopPort>31001</stopPort>
diff --git a/addons/hbase-bridge/pom.xml b/addons/hbase-bridge/pom.xml
index a36ea3f..3709195 100644
--- a/addons/hbase-bridge/pom.xml
+++ b/addons/hbase-bridge/pom.xml
@@ -435,6 +435,10 @@
<key>embedded.solr.directory</key>
<value>${project.build.directory}</value>
</syst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
+ </syst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>
<stopPort>31001</stopPort>
diff --git a/addons/hive-bridge/pom.xml b/addons/hive-bridge/pom.xml
index 16fe0d6..0024079 100755
--- a/addons/hive-bridge/pom.xml
+++ b/addons/hive-bridge/pom.xml
@@ -409,6 +409,10 @@
<key>embedded.solr.directory</key>
<value>${project.build.directory}</value>
</syst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
+ </syst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>
<stopPort>31001</stopPort>
diff --git a/addons/impala-bridge/pom.xml b/addons/impala-bridge/pom.xml
index 5faf2d5..4338e4d 100644
--- a/addons/impala-bridge/pom.xml
+++ b/addons/impala-bridge/pom.xml
@@ -440,6 +440,10 @@
<key>embedded.solr.directory</key>
<value>${project.build.directory}</value>
</syst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
+ </syst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>
<stopPort>31001</stopPort>
diff --git a/addons/kafka-bridge/pom.xml b/addons/kafka-bridge/pom.xml
index 3355c44..7b95aa3 100644
--- a/addons/kafka-bridge/pom.xml
+++ b/addons/kafka-bridge/pom.xml
@@ -287,6 +287,10 @@
<key>embedded.solr.directory</key>
<value>${project.build.directory}</value>
</syst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
+ </syst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>
<stopPort>31001</stopPort>
diff --git a/addons/sqoop-bridge/pom.xml b/addons/sqoop-bridge/pom.xml
index 27f0b65..0d89e98 100644
--- a/addons/sqoop-bridge/pom.xml
+++ b/addons/sqoop-bridge/pom.xml
@@ -338,6 +338,10 @@
<key>embedded.solr.directory</key>
<value>${project.build.directory}</value>
</syst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
+ </syst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>
<stopPort>31001</stopPort>
diff --git a/addons/storm-bridge/pom.xml b/addons/storm-bridge/pom.xml
index 03ca5fc..ee73229 100644
--- a/addons/storm-bridge/pom.xml
+++ b/addons/storm-bridge/pom.xml
@@ -450,6 +450,10 @@
<key>embedded.solr.directory</key>
<value>${project.build.directory}</value>
</syst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
+ </syst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>
<stopPort>31001</stopPort>
diff --git a/graphdb/api/pom.xml b/graphdb/api/pom.xml
index 9cdbe66..0d8acc0 100644
--- a/graphdb/api/pom.xml
+++ b/graphdb/api/pom.xml
@@ -49,7 +49,7 @@
<dependency>
<groupId>org.apache.tinkerpop</groupId>
<artifactId>gremlin-core</artifactId>
- <version>3.3.3</version>
+ <version>${tinkerpop.version}</version>
</dependency>
</dependencies>
diff --git a/graphdb/janus/pom.xml b/graphdb/janus/pom.xml
index adc9a9e..7d7e675 100644
--- a/graphdb/janus/pom.xml
+++ b/graphdb/janus/pom.xml
@@ -34,9 +34,7 @@
Some dependencies, like slf4j are excluded from the jar because they are included in Atlas -->
<properties>
- <tinkerpop.version>3.3.3</tinkerpop.version>
<checkstyle.failOnViolation>false</checkstyle.failOnViolation>
- <lucene-solr.version>7.3.0</lucene-solr.version>
</properties>
<dependencies>
@@ -236,7 +234,7 @@
<classifier>tests</classifier>
<scope>test</scope>
</dependency>
-
+
<dependency>
<groupId>org.mockito</groupId>
<artifactId>mockito-all</artifactId>
diff --git a/graphdb/janus/src/main/java/org/apache/atlas/repository/graphdb/janus/AtlasJanusGraph.java b/graphdb/janus/src/main/java/org/apache/atlas/repository/graphdb/janus/AtlasJanusGraph.java
index 4d581ec..bbc7630 100644
--- a/graphdb/janus/src/main/java/org/apache/atlas/repository/graphdb/janus/AtlasJanusGraph.java
+++ b/graphdb/janus/src/main/java/org/apache/atlas/repository/graphdb/janus/AtlasJanusGraph.java
@@ -343,7 +343,7 @@ public class AtlasJanusGraph implements AtlasGraph<AtlasJanusVertex, AtlasJanusE
public void releaseGremlinScriptEngine(ScriptEngine scriptEngine) {
if (scriptEngine instanceof GremlinGroovyScriptEngine) {
try {
- ((GremlinGroovyScriptEngine) scriptEngine).close();
+ ((GremlinGroovyScriptEngine) scriptEngine).reset();
} catch (Exception e) {
// ignore
}
diff --git a/pom.xml b/pom.xml
index c18836b..cd86573 100644
--- a/pom.xml
+++ b/pom.xml
@@ -657,7 +657,10 @@
<jersey.version>1.19</jersey.version>
<jsr.version>1.1</jsr.version>
- <janus.version>0.3.1</janus.version>
+ <janus.version>0.4.0</janus.version>
+ <tinkerpop.version>3.4.1</tinkerpop.version>
+ <lucene-solr.version>7.3.0</lucene-solr.version>
+
<hadoop.version>3.1.1</hadoop.version>
<hbase.version>2.0.2</hbase.version>
<solr.version>7.5.0</solr.version>
diff --git a/webapp/pom.xml b/webapp/pom.xml
index c3a4df3..57cab62 100755
--- a/webapp/pom.xml
+++ b/webapp/pom.xml
@@ -689,7 +689,11 @@
</systemProperty>
<systemProperty>
<name>org.eclipse.jetty.annotations.maxWait</name>
- <value>3000</value>
+ <value>5000</value>
+ </systemProperty>
+ <systemProperty>
+ <name>org.eclipse.jetty.annotations.maxWait</name>
+ <value>5000</value>
</systemProperty>
</systemProperties>
<stopKey>atlas-stop</stopKey>